Nicholas Holt was an early New England settler arriving in 1635 on the ship James during the Great Migration. He was first in Newbury but later in Andover where he raised a large family with his three wives. This new compilation provides a comprehensive consideration of the descendants of Nicholas Holt through six generations. Both male and female lines of descent are covered providing additional detail and incorporating many Abbotts, Farnums, Johnsons, Grays, Chandlers, Ingalls, Ballards, Russells, and many more names. More than 1,000 complete families are covered. Name index, references, and footnotes are included.
Robert Russell and his wife Mary Marshall resided in Andover where they raised a family of ten children. This is one of the first attempts at a comprehensive compilation of the descendants of Robert Russell and Mary Marshall. This volume follows the descendants of Robert and Mary Russell to the sixth generation and includes both male and female lines of descent. As female lines are followed, many members of the Holt, Farnum, Abbott, Ingalls, Osgood, Goodell, and Johnson families are covered in this volume with coverage of 983 complete families. Footnotes, references, master family list, and name index are included.
"The Descendants of George Abbott of Andover and Hannah Chandler Through Six Generations" is a follow-up and extension of "The Descendants of George Abbott of Andover and Hannah Chandler" that was published in 2018 and which provided coverage to children of the fifth generation. This volume includes the coverage of the first four generations of families that was previously covered and adds coverage for the complete fifth generation families.This compilation is an attempt to provide as complete information as possible of the descendants of George Abbott and Hannah Chandler including complete families through five generations and all of the children that comprise the sixth generation. This includes coverage of more than 1,200 complete families. Both the male and female lines are included so there are many Chandlers, Holts, Ingalls, Fryes, Blanchards, Ballards, and many more names. Within these pages you will find the full range of human behavior: individuals with great accomplishments, those with humble, ordinary lives, and those who faced incredible hardship and tragedy. There are personal struggles including poverty and reliance on almshouses for subsistence, out-of-wedlock children, and persons who wrestled with alcoholism, depression, and other mental illness. There are also Harvard graduates, attorneys, physicians, and clergymen. There are women pioneers persevering in the face of tremendous challenges. There are the first settlers of many communities in Massachusetts, Connecticut, New Hampshire, Maine, Vermont, Pennsylvania, and upstate New York. Moving into the fifth generation who will find more descendants who made their way to Canada and into Ohio and Michigan and the southern colonies.Although this is a genealogical compilation, I hope that the presentation of the individual families will allow at least some sense of the humanity of these individuals and their contributions to the founding and development of the country.
